Kinetics of beta-picoline oxidation to nicotinic acid over vanadia-titania catalyst. 3. The oxidation of nicotinic acid
The oxidation of nicotinic acid (NA) over binary vanadia-titania catalysts with different contents of residual sulfate ions (0.2 and 2.8 wt. %) was Studied at 250-300 degrees C in the feed reaction mixture of the composition NA : O-2: H2O = 0.01-0.17 : 5-20 : 0-20 (vol. %), with nitrogen as a balance. The kinetic parameters of the process were determined. It was shown that even a ten-fold increase in the content of residual sulfate ions in the samples has no significant effect on the kinetics of the NA oxidation.
